Get Flowers In Any Season

How to Make a Wedding Bouquet with Silk Flowers | Silk Flower Bouquet | Bridal Bouquet

One of the biggest benefits of learning how to make a bouquet of fake flowers is the ability to choose any blooms, no matter the season, without worrying about surging costs due to flower shortages or market fluctuations. Fake flowers dont go out of season, so your bouquet can contain any type of blooms you prefer.

When you use real flowers for your bridal bouquet, there are limitations based on season, availability, and price of the blossom. With artificial flowers, you can create a DIY wedding bouquet with any flower you want and different colors to match your theme.

S For Building The Bouquet

HOW TO Make an EASY and BEAUTIFUL Silk Wedding Bouquet | Artificial Flowers from Silk Scapes

Step 1: Gather up a few of your pink mauve roses and use them as your base for the bouquet. Use floral tape to secure them together.

Step 2: Trim the greenery off of any stems that you feel necessary. You’ll add additional greenery later so don’t worry about saving the trimmings. Mix in your Real Touch Dutchess roses around the base and secure them with floral tape once they’re in place.

Step 3: Create some shape with your bouquet by building it out with your other blooms in clusters like we’ve shown below. Don’t be afraid to move some things around if it doesn’t feel right! Once everything is in its place, secure with more floral tape.

Step 4: Add in some greenery around the perimeter of the bouquet. We used 3 different kinds of eucalyptus for this bouquet. For this step, we added our seeded eucalyptus and the green burgundy eucalyptus stems.

Step 5: Establish the “front” side of your bouquet. Here, you’ll add your lilacs in and don’t be afraid to bend them a bit so they create a draping look.

Step 6: To make this bouquet really stand out, we chose a focal eucalyptus stem for added texture and shape. We used a spiral eucalyptus branch. Fill the perimeter with a few trimmings of this larger stem.

Step 7: Once your flowers and your greenery are where you’d like them, secure the last stems with floral tape. Trim your stems down to one height, but make sure it’s comfortable enough for you to hold. We left about 8 inches of stem.

How To Hand Tie Your Own Wedding Bouquet

If you have learned to creative arrange the flowers for a wedding bouquet, then the next step is to hand-tie them. Get here all the tips to tie together nicely the bouquet. First, build the foundation using greenery, fillers and foliage and next feature flowers in the center. Wrap floral wire around the stems and then hide the wire with floral tape or accent ribbon. I had always known that I wanted to get bridal portraits done, but hadnt thought of using a silk flower bouquet until I started doing some research.

Using silk flowers means you get to keep the bouquet forever! Also, its much more user-friendly the day of your bridal portraits. Sessions are usually about two hours long, and youre holding different poses, walking around, tossing your veil about, etc. You dont want to be worrying about live flowers staying fresh , petals falling off, wilting or browning before your session!

It’s Not Tacky To Use Silk Wedding Flowers In Some Places That Are Outside Of The Direct Line Of Vision

You can use them in arrangements that are high up on a wall or in the distance. Sub a few fake flowers to swag the orchestra balcony at the church and no one will know. Consider other faraway places to place your fake flowers like in the dark dance room near the band or over door arches.

The Benefits Of A Diy Bouquet

How to Create a Bridal Bouquet with Artificial Silk Flowers

If it fits your budget, opting to have a floral designer create a gorgeous bouquet is a great option. However, much of the cost from a professionally crafted bouquet comes from the labor involved. Certainly, theres cost associated with sourcing fresh blooms, but the cost goes up depending on the amount of time spent and the complexity of the design. If youre able to skip it and do the labor yourself, youll definitely be able to shave quite a bit off of your floral budget.
